Administrative Assistant to the President


The Marine Environmental Research Institute (MERI) is seeking a highly organized professional to fill the full-time position of Administrative Assistant to the President/CEO. 

Located on the mid-Maine coast, the Marine Environmental Research Institute is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it charitable organization dedicated to protecting ocean life and human health through scientific research, education and advocacy.

The organization is poised to expand its influence on marine and toxics policy on a national scale and the individual who fills this key position will be instrumental in assisting the President in the implementation of this strategy. 

Job Summary
Assists the President by providing administrative support for all aspects of her work. Serves as liaison for the President’s internal and external constituencies. Contacts include Board of Directors, staff, business, professional and environmental organizations’ staff and executives, and government staff. 

Scope
This position manages support and communication functions for the President. 

Representative Duties
• Manages the President's schedule; coordinates meetings, interviews, appointments, and travel arrangements
• Serves as liaison for the President’s diverse constituencies
• Monitors the universe of environmental news; briefs the President on developing trends and issues
• Monitors President’s communications including email and phone calls 
• Develops background research for projects, media and/or development opportunities
• Coordinates information for strategic communications, branding, and development 
• Edits speeches, press releases, presentations, and other documents as needed
• Coordinates and updates the President’s presence on the website 
• Performs other duties as assigned.

Qualifications
At minimum, a Bachelor’s degree with five years of professional experience is required. Applicants must possess excellent communications and research skills, written and oral; knowledge of organizational procedures, events management, and scheduling. High degree of computer literacy. Proficiency with the Microsoft Office suite and familiarity with a Mac platform. Must be familiar with the environmental science, law and/or policy fields. Knowledge of nonprofit management and development a plus. 

The successful candidate will possess the following attributes: highly professional, self-starting, dedicated to the mission, creative, original thinker and problem-solver; strong organizational ability; sense of purpose – goal and achievement oriented; ability to work under stress, meet deadlines; strong people management skills; strong sense of humor.
